Finite-volume correction on the hadronic vacuum polarization contribution to the muon g?2 in lattice QCD

Abstract
We study the finite-volume correction on the hadronic vacuum polarization contribution to the muon g?2 (ahvpμ) in lattice QCD at (near) physical pion mass using two different volumes: (5.4??fm)4 and (8.1??fm)4. We use an optimized AMA technique for noise reduction on Nf=2+1 PACS gauge configurations with stout-smeared clover-Wilson fermion action and Iwasaki gauge action at a single lattice cut-off a?1=2.33??GeV. The calculation is performed for the quark-connected light-quark contribution in the isospin symmetric limit. We take into account the effects of backward state propagation by extending a temporal boundary condition. In addition, we study a quark-mass correction to tune to the exact same physical pion mass on different volume and compare those correction with chiral perturbation. We find 10(26)×10?10 difference for light quark ahvpμ between (5.4??fm)4 and (8.1??fm)4 lattice in 146 MeV pion.
